After reading the dictionary for a day, here's my poem

called letter A

I'm an anonymity on the back burner

buried deep down in the trenches of the asylum behind you.

just an accessory you've

grown accustomed not to

seeking your aboriginal gaze;

only to avert it from my abysmal glance

for I will shower you with acupuncture needles-

laced with amphetamine.

life will be less complicated

without my barbiturate kiss.

If I could go back in time.

find the apathetic amber in you.

allude the activist who's astute eyes drain me.

find you standing alone on the asphalt

up their so high abashed

abstaining from muttering how I feel.
